Varda Space has successfully landed in Australia that provides critical data that could drive the production in space and hyperschall technologies.
The Startup Vardas Winnebago-2 (W-2) capsule based in California launched Together with 130 other payloads on January 14th on a SpaceX Falcon 9 Rocket, 12 Rideshare Mission on the van. After six weeks in the orbit, the capsule made a fiery jump through Earth’s atmosphereLanding on February 28th in the Koonibba Test Range in South Australia, which is operated by Southern Start.
W-2 contained a spectrometer from the Air Force Research Laboratory (AFRL) and a Varda Enhanced Pharmaceutical Reactor for the company’s inorbit manufacturing plans. The capsule used a heat sign with a thermal insulation system (TPS), which was developed in collaboration with the AMES Research Center of NASA in Silicon Valley.
The W-2 capsule of Varda Space Industries created a fireball on February 28, 2025 during its re-entry into the earth’s atmosphere | Credit: Varda Space Industries
The spectrometer, the optical recording of plasmen in the re-entry environment (Ospree) sensor, is expected to provide the first in-situ-optical emission measurements of the re-entry environment according to Mach 15. The instrument is part of a long -term partnership between Varda and AFRL for testing hyper noon systems and re -entry technologies.

“We are enthusiastic about having W-2 back on our home planet and proud to support significant re-entry research for our government partners, while we are still building a flourishing basis for economic expansion Low earth ornament“Will Bruy, CEO of Varda Space Industries, said in A opinion.
The 265 pound capsule (120 kilograms) was supported in the orbit by a pioneer satellite bus, which was built by Rocket laboratoryThe power, communication, drive and other necessary skills offered.

According to officials, the successful return to the earth of W-2 was also a breakthrough for the Australian space sector.
“This return shows the possibility that Australia will be a responsible start and return hub for the global space community and the geographical advantages of our expansive continent from benefits,” said Enrico Palermo, head of the Australian space agency.
The W-2 landing came one year after the company’s first mission, W-1, the landed in Utah In February 2024. The mission saw W-1 in orbit for eight months before delivering an antiviral medicine to earth crystals that was grown in the circulation.
